High water consumption, Low Power

Featured Replies

Hello

I have a 2011 Fiesta Titanium 1.6 Diesel. 

I am filling the water reservoir every other day. There are no signs of the engine overheating, or leaks. The water and oil are both clean. No warning lights/codes apparent.

I have left the engine running for a while and the water seems to maintain its capacity.

The turbo also does not seem to kick in anymore, however the engine and still runs. Just a lot less power. More like a 1L engine than a 1.6L turbo.

There is also a problem with the heating, too. I am lead to believe the climate control actuator is broken, so I either get ice cold air or really hot air, there is nothing in between.

Could these issues be linked? Does anyone have any experience with these issues?

Understandably the car is getting on now and has a fair few miles on the clock, so looking for advice before spending a lot of money on repairs.

Cheers!



Check exhaust for steam ? Head gasket amongst other things.
